How does Aveeno work?
Aveeno belongs to a group of treatments called emollients. These are substances which soften the skin and hydrate it, while also reducing itching and flaking.
There are several ingredients in Aveeno which help to moisturise and soften your skin, bringing relief from dry and flaky skin.
Aveeno Cream contains colloidal oatmeal (finely ground oats). This natural ingredient is renowned for its soothing and moisturising qualities. The oatmeal in Aveeno is added to a base of other moisturising ingredients, such as liquid paraffin and glycerin.
Liquid paraffin forms an oil coating on the surface of the skin, preventing water from evaporating.
When glycerin is absorbed through the skin, it acts by drawing water to itself. This traps water just below the skin’s surface to help keep the skin moisturised.
How do I use Aveeno?
Aveeno Cream is a moisturising cream that should be applied directly to the skin. It should not be ingested or used internally.
Moisturisers such as Aveeno Cream should be used on a regular basis to prevent the skin from drying out. You may need to use Aveeno multiple times a day, especially if you have chronic skin conditions.
Before using Aveeno Cream in a pump, you will need to prime the pump.
Rotate the top of the plunger to unlock it, then press down the pump a few times until the cream comes out. This is to ensure that the pump will produce a consistent quantity of Aveeno Cream.
To Apply Aveeno Cream:
- Dispense a small amount of cream onto your hand.
- Gently massage the cream into your skin until it is absorbed.
- Wash your hands after using Aveeno Cream.
You can use Aveeno Cream as often as required.
Use Aveeno Cream after washing to lock in moisture. When you wash, soaps can wash away the natural oils that protect and hydrate your skin. Applying a moisturiser straight after washing can rehydrate the skin and prevent it from drying out.
Aveeno and other emollients can make surfaces extra slippery. Take extra care when using emollients.
What should I do if I accidentally use too much Aveeno Cream?
If you apply too much Aveeno Cream, simply wipe away the excess cream with a tissue or paper towel and discard it in the bin. Accidentally using too much Aveeno Cream is unlikely to have an adverse effect on your health.

Who should not use Aveeno Cream?
Aveeno may not be suitable for you.
Do not use Aveeno:
- on broken, cut or irritated skin
- on areas of skin that have been recently shaved
- around the eyes, nose, mouth
- on the genitals or around the groin
Aveeno Cream is not a suitable treatment for acne or rosacea.
Speak to your doctor or a pharmacist before using Aveeno Cream if you:
- are experiencing dry skin on your face
- are using other medicated skin treatments
If you are unsure whether Aveeno is suitable for you, speak to your doctor or ask a pharmacist for advice.

Other safety information
Always follow the directions in the patient information leaflet. If you are unsure how to use the product, consult a pharmacist.
Warning: Emollients, such as Aveeno, are flammable. Do not use Aveeno around naked flames. Wash surfaces that come into contact with Aveeno, such as clothing and bedding, to reduce the risk of fires.
Do not use Aveeno Cream past the expiry date printed on the packaging.
Never throw away Aveeno Cream via household or water waste as this can harm the environment. Instead, you should take any unwanted or expired medication to your local pharmacy and ask them to dispose them safely for you.
Always store Aveeno Cream out of sight and reach from children and pets.
Never share Aveeno with others - even if they are experiencing the same symptoms or have been diagnosed with the same condition as you.

Can I use Aveeno Cream alongside other topical treatments?
Speak to your doctor before using Aveeno in conjunction with other topical therapies. Moisturisers may help other topical treatments to be absorbed more quickly.
You should wait half an hour before using Aveeno Cream and any other topical therapy cream. This is to prevent Aveeno Cream from being diluted by other products - which can reduce its effectiveness - and vice versa.
